Abstract
Synchronous fluorescence spectra (SFS) of sewage samples from three different sewage treatment plants show well-defined and reproducible structure when recorded with an off-set wavelength of 20 nm. The major peak at about 280 nm is attributed primarily to the biodegradable aromatic hydrocarbon constituent. This conclusion is based on conventional and SF spectroscopic analysis of the sewage samples (both settled sewage and final effluent) and their potential chromophoric constituents. The peak at about 380 nm in the SFS of the sewage samples is found to be mainly due to the non-biodegradable component.
